I trolled Lake Camanche (in the foothills near Stockton, CA) on
Thursday from 0900 to about 1600. A fighting mad two pounder took my
Rapala Firetiger at 20' near Big Hat Island during the first hour to
get my day started off right. He took several good runs from the boat
before winding up in the net. I trolled six more hours for three more
fish - and couldn't buy that limit fish. (Five trout is a limit.)

The day was breezy but warm and sunny. The afternoon grew just plain
windy and single-handed trolling became a chore. One other fisherman
was trolling nearby with his buddy and proudly showed me their eight
pounder and about a five pounder. They said the big ones hit much
earlier in the morning. The fella is leading in the current trout
derby now taking place on Camanche through May 24.

Perhaps the wind will lie down next week and I can get out to Suisun
Bay for some more sturgeon fishing. #$%^@!! wind!!

Thanks Vic - hopefully next week it will be sturgeon. If only the wind
would stop blowing on the delta I could get out to fish the pretty
fair tides Wed or Thurs. This time of year the summer wind pattern out
there is constant, I guess due to the hot valley vs the marine air of
the ocean.
